When's the best time for a beach holiday in Madawaska?
Plan your trip to the beach with a look at weather throughout the year in Madawaska: The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 16°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of -8°C. The snowiest months in Madawaska are February, January, December and April, with each month seeing an average of 100 cm of snowfall.
What is there to see and do around Madawaska?
After arriving and checking into your hotel, you’ll probably want to explore your surroundings. Make time for a range of local attractions, which include Bark Lake and Upper Madawaska River Provincial Park. You can also pay a visit to Opeongo River Provincial Park or Papineau Lake for more to see and do.
